Cook held for murder at former minister Selja's house

Written by : TNM

The News Minute | August 12, 2014 | 12:43 pm IST

New Delhi: A 35-year-old cook has been arrested for murdering a man in the servant quarter of former union minister Kumari Selja's house, police said on Tuesday.

"Sanjay (husband of Kumari Selja's maid) was beaten to death by (cook) Anil Yadav in a scuffle Monday," said a police official.

Yadav was detained as he had some injury marks on his face.

"Yadav's clothes, which he was wearing during the murder, were also recovered," the official added.
